Admission <strong>of</strong><br />
Resident Seminarians<br />
Prerequisites<br />
Seminarians enrolling in the theology program<br />
must meet the following requirements:<br />
1. A bachelor’s degree from an accredited<br />
college or university;<br />
2. A minimum <strong>of</strong> 30 earned semester credits<br />
in philosophy and 12 in undergraduate<br />
theology or religious studies in prescribed<br />
fields <strong>of</strong> study;<br />
3. Prerequisite familiarity with the western<br />
intellectual tradition in history, arts and<br />
literature, communications, and<br />
rhetoric, as obtained through appropriate<br />
coursework in these areas.<br />
Admission Requirements<br />
The applicant must schedule an admissions<br />
interview, and should have the following<br />
materials sent to the Vice Rector’s Office at<br />
the address below as soon as possible:<br />
1. Official original transcripts from all<br />
high schools, colleges, universities, and<br />
theologates attended;<br />
2. Application form and fee;<br />
3. Official letter <strong>of</strong> recommendation from<br />
sponsoring diocese or religious community;<br />
4. Students transferring from other seminaries<br />
or formation programs must submit<br />
their most recent evaluations from<br />
those institutions;<br />
5. Baptism and confirmation certificates;<br />
6. Statement on the priesthood;<br />
7. Evaluations and recommendations from<br />
previous seminaries or houses <strong>of</strong> formation;<br />
8. Autobiography;<br />
9. Job or ministerial performance review<br />
from current or most recent employer;<br />
10. Physical exam report, including tuberculosis<br />
and HIV test results;<br />
11. Copy <strong>of</strong> current visa and passport if<br />
non-US citizen and address in country <strong>of</strong><br />
citizenship;<br />
12. Copy <strong>of</strong> latest TOEFL iBT scores and<br />
reports,: (minimum required score <strong>of</strong><br />
91) taken within the past year, if nonnative<br />
speaker <strong>of</strong> English;<br />
13. Federal and state criminal background<br />
checks;<br />
14. Psychological report;<br />
15. Two recent photos.<br />
An Admissions Committee reviews applications<br />
<strong>of</strong> prospective resident seminarians and<br />
makes its recommendations to the President<br />
Rector who sends notice regarding acceptance<br />
both to the applicant and to his sponsoring<br />
diocese. For an application packet with<br />
